By Jason Boyd | 29 March 2025.

Your WordPress Security Is At Risk

Warning Signs You're About To Be Hacked

a black padlock with a white grid on it

Photo by TheDigitalArtist on Pixabay

Introduction

Every 39 seconds, a website is hacked somewhere in the world. For WordPress sites, which power over 40% of the web, the frequency is even more alarming—with an estimated 90,000 attacks occurring every minute against WordPress installations globally.

As a business owner relying on your WordPress website, these statistics aren’t just concerning—they’re terrifying. Your website isn’t merely a digital brochure; it’s often the primary touchpoint with customers, a crucial revenue generator, and a repository of sensitive information. When its security is compromised, the consequences extend far beyond technical inconvenience.

Are WordPress security issues keeping you awake at night? You’re justified in your concern. The platform’s popularity makes it a prime target for hackers, and its plugin ecosystem—while valuable for functionality—creates multiple potential entry points for malicious actors.

What makes WordPress security particularly challenging is that by the time most business owners realise they’ve been hacked, significant damage has already occurred. Customer data may have been compromised, your brand reputation tarnished, and Google may have already blacklisted your site—all while you were completely unaware of the breach.

The consequences can be devastating: lost revenue, regulatory penalties for data breaches, broken customer trust, and weeks of costly remediation efforts. For small to medium businesses, the average cost of a website security breach now exceeds £25,000 when considering all direct and indirect costs.

This guide will help you identify five critical warning signs that your WordPress site’s security is at risk—before you experience a catastrophic breach. Unlike typical security articles that focus on technical solutions, I’ll examine the early indicators that even non-technical business owners can recognise, potentially saving you from significant financial and reputational damage.

By the end of this article, you’ll understand whether your WordPress site shows symptoms of security vulnerabilities requiring immediate attention, and why standard security plugins may not be providing the protection you assume.

Let’s explore how to tell if your WordPress site is at risk of being hacked—or may already be compromised without your knowledge.

1. Your WordPress Site Is Suddenly Slow or Behaving Strangely

Is Your WordPress Site Acting Strange? The First Sign of Security Compromise

One of the earliest and most frequently overlooked signs of a security breach is unexplained performance issues. Your once-snappy WordPress site suddenly becomes sluggish, pages take ages to load, or the admin dashboard freezes intermittently. These aren’t merely inconvenient technical glitches—they’re often the first visible symptoms of malicious code execution.

The business impact extends beyond mere frustration. While you’re trying to diagnose what appears to be a performance issue, customers are abandoning your slow site, and malicious processes may be quietly harvesting data or establishing deeper access to your systems. Each day these performance anomalies continue, your business loses customers and remains vulnerable to escalating damage.

What happens behind the scenes is that many WordPress malware variants and unauthorised scripts consume server resources while performing their malicious functions—whether that’s sending spam, mining cryptocurrency, or establishing command-and-control connections to external servers.

Most business owners mistakenly attribute these symptoms to hosting issues or plugin conflicts. While these can indeed cause performance problems, sudden and unexplained slowdowns—especially when you haven’t recently made changes—should immediately raise security concerns.

A simple check anyone can perform: Compare your site’s current response time to historical performance using tools like GTmetrix or PageSpeed Insights. If there’s a significant degradation without corresponding changes to your site’s content or traffic, it warrants immediate security investigation.

One client dismissed persistent slowdowns as “hosting issues” for weeks, only to discover later that their site had been compromised and was being used to mine cryptocurrency during off-hours—costing them not only in customer experience but also in significantly inflated hosting bills due to the excessive resource usage.

2. Google Has Flagged Your Site as Dangerous or Deceptive

Why Does Google Say My Site Is Dangerous? Understanding Security Warnings

Perhaps the most alarming moment for any business owner is discovering that Google has flagged your website as “dangerous” or “deceptive” in search results or browser warnings. This isn’t merely a technical hiccup—it’s a crisis-level event with immediate business consequences.

When Google displays security warnings about your site, the impact is devastating:

  • Visitors see alarming red warnings before even reaching your content
  • Chrome and other browsers actively block access to your pages
  • Your search visibility plummets as Google protects its users
  • Your brand suffers serious reputational damage with potential customers

Google doesn’t flag sites arbitrarily. Their automated systems have detected strong indicators of compromise—most commonly malware, phishing content, or deceptive redirects that have been injected into your WordPress installation. By the time Google flags your site, the security breach has typically been present for some time.

The most insidious aspect is that these malicious elements are often invisible to you as the site owner. Sophisticated WordPress malware can selectively display content or redirect only specific visitor types (such as search engine users or mobile visitors) while appearing normal when you access the site yourself.

To check if Google has flagged your site, visit the Google Search Console Security Issues report or use Google’s Safe Browsing Site Status tool. Even if you’re not seeing warnings directly, Google might be showing them to some portion of your visitors.

A business coaching client discovered that their lead generation had mysteriously dropped by 80% over two weeks. The culprit? Google had flagged their site due to hidden malware that was redirecting mobile visitors to pharmaceutical spam sites—something they never saw when checking the site from their desktop computer.

3. You’re Finding Unexpected Admin Users or Login Attempts

Unknown WordPress Admin Users? You’re Under Attack

WordPress’s admin area is the central command centre for your business website. When unfamiliar users appear in your administrator list—or you notice unusual patterns of login attempts—these aren’t random anomalies. They are direct evidence of targeted attempts to compromise your site’s security.

The business stakes couldn’t be higher. Unauthorised admin access means potential control over:

  • Your entire customer database
  • Payment processing capabilities
  • Business email communications
  • Content across your entire web presence
  • The ability to install additional malicious software

WordPress sites are constantly subjected to brute force attacks—automated attempts to guess username and password combinations. According to security researchers, the average WordPress site experiences over 90 unauthorised login attempts every day, with that number rising significantly for business and e-commerce sites.

Many business owners don’t realise that successful breaches often begin with compromised credentials. Once attackers gain admin access, they frequently create additional admin accounts with innocuous names as “back doors” to maintain access even if the original compromised account is discovered and removed.

You can check for suspicious admin users by reviewing your WordPress Users section and looking for accounts you don’t recognise. Additionally, security plugins or server logs can reveal patterns of failed login attempts that indicate targeted attacks.

A small e-commerce client was shocked to discover an admin account named “support_admin” that had been created three months earlier—without their knowledge. This compromised account had been used to insert credit card skimming code that had been quietly capturing customer payment details for months before detection.

4. Your Site Contains Links or Content You Didn’t Create

Strange Links on Your WordPress Site? The Silent Signs of Compromise

One of the most common objectives for WordPress hackers is SEO spam—injecting hidden links or content into your site to boost rankings for unrelated sites, typically in gambling, pharmaceuticals, or adult content industries. These modifications are designed to be difficult for site owners to detect while leveraging your site’s authority.

The business consequences extend beyond the “ick factor” of being associated with such content:

  • Search engines may penalise your entire domain for spam tactics
  • Your legitimate content gets outranked by manipulated pages
  • Your authority and trustworthiness metrics decline
  • Your brand becomes associated with unrelated, often unsavoury industries

What makes these injections particularly dangerous is their sophistication. Modern WordPress malware often uses SQL injection techniques to insert content directly into your database, making it invisible in your theme files or hard to find through standard WordPress interfaces.

The injected content might only appear to search engines but remain hidden from human visitors, or it might be inserted into legitimate pages in ways that blend with your actual content. Some variants even create entirely new, hidden pages that site owners never see in their dashboard.

To check for content injections, try viewing your site while logged out or using Google’s “site:” search operator to see how your pages appear in search results. Look for unexpected keywords or links that don’t match your business content.

A professional services firm discovered that dozens of gambling-related keywords had been clandestinely added to the footer of their WordPress theme—visible only in the site’s HTML code but not in the visual display. The issue was only discovered after clients began asking why the firm was promoting online casinos.

5. You’re Not Sure If Your WordPress Site Is Secure

How Do I Know If My WordPress Site Is Secure? Uncertainty Is a Warning Sign

Perhaps the most overlooked warning sign is simply not knowing the state of your WordPress security. If you can’t confidently answer basic questions about your site’s security posture, this uncertainty itself represents significant business risk.

This uncertainty creates tangible business vulnerabilities:

  • You can’t verify compliance with data protection regulations
  • You lack confidence when assuring customers their data is safe
  • You have no baseline to recognise when security incidents occur
  • You can’t identify which security investments would provide actual value

Many WordPress site owners operate under dangerous assumptions: that their hosting provider handles all security, that installing a security plugin provides complete protection, or that small businesses aren’t targets for hackers. None of these assumptions is valid in today’s threat landscape.

WordPress security requires active monitoring and management. Without scheduled security assessments, proactive vulnerability patching, and incident response planning, your business website exists in a state of perpetual risk—not knowing whether you’re secure today or if tomorrow will bring a devastating breach.

A basic self-assessment anyone can perform: Can you answer when your WordPress core, themes, and plugins were last updated? Do you know exactly which plugins are active on your site and whether any have known vulnerabilities? Can you confirm whether your site has proper security headers implemented? If these questions leave you uncertain, your site security requires immediate attention.

A client who runs multiple WordPress sites for different business ventures admitted they had “no idea” about their security status beyond having “some security plugin installed years ago.” My subsequent audit revealed 17 critical vulnerabilities across their sites, several of which showed evidence of previous compromise that had gone completely undetected.

The Business Cost of WordPress Security Breaches

What Happens If My WordPress Site Gets Hacked? The True Business Cost

To understand the urgency of addressing WordPress security issues, business owners need to comprehend the full financial impact of security breaches. The costs extend far beyond the immediate technical remediation expenses.

A comprehensive assessment of breach costs should include:

  1. Direct Remediation Costs:
    • Technical investigation and cleaning (typically £500-£3,000)
    • Security hardening implementation (£500-£2,000)
    • Content restoration from backups (if available)
  2. Business Continuity Costs:
    • Lost revenue during downtime (varies by business model)
    • Staff productivity losses during incident response
    • Emergency vendor fees for expedited resolution
  3. Reputational and Customer Costs:
    • Customer compensation or goodwill gestures
    • Lost future business from affected customers
    • Marketing costs to rebuild reputation
    • Management time diverted to crisis communications
  4. Regulatory and Compliance Costs:
    • Potential GDPR fines (up to 4% of annual turnover)
    • Mandatory breach notification expenses
    • Legal consultation fees
    • Additional compliance requirements post-breach

For many small to medium businesses, the combined cost of these factors typically ranges from £15,000 to £40,000 per incident—with that figure rising dramatically if customer data is compromised or if the breach remains undetected for an extended period.

Most concerningly, security research indicates that 60% of small businesses that experience a significant breach close within six months, unable to absorb the financial and reputational damage.

Why DIY Security Approaches Put WordPress Sites at Risk

The Limitations of DIY WordPress Security

Many business owners attempt to address WordPress security through self-service approaches: installing security plugins, following online tutorials, or implementing recommendations from WordPress blogs. While these efforts are well-intentioned, they often create a dangerous false sense of security.

The limitations of DIY WordPress security include:

  • Fragmented Protection: Security plugins address some vectors but leave others completely exposed, creating protection gaps
  • Configuration Complexity: Most security tools require expert configuration to be effective, with default settings providing minimal protection
  • Evolving Threats: The WordPress threat landscape changes weekly, with DIY approaches typically lagging months behind current attack techniques
  • Technical Debt: As WordPress sites grow and evolve, security implementations become increasingly complex and difficult to maintain
  • Missing Context: Generic security advice doesn’t account for your specific business requirements, plugins, or hosting environment

Perhaps most importantly, DIY security lacks the systematic approach that effective WordPress security requires: regular security assessments, vulnerability scanning, file integrity monitoring, and proper incident response planning.

The most dangerous outcome is the false confidence that often results from implementing partial security measures. Business owners believe they’re protected because they’ve taken some action, while sophisticated attack vectors remain completely unaddressed.

Conclusion: Protecting Your WordPress Business Asset

The warning signs I’ve discussed aren’t mere technical curiosities—they represent real threats to your business continuity, customer trust, and bottom line. If you’ve recognised multiple warning signs in your own WordPress site, your business is likely carrying significant security risk right now.

Effective WordPress security requires a holistic approach that addresses vulnerabilities at multiple levels: server configuration, WordPress core, themes and plugins, access controls, and ongoing monitoring. When these elements work together coherently, WordPress can indeed be a secure platform for your business.

Even if you’re not ready to implement comprehensive security measures immediately, understanding your specific vulnerabilities is an essential first step. A professional WordPress security audit can identify exactly where your risks lie and provide a prioritised roadmap for improvements.

Remember that WordPress security is an investment in business continuity and customer trust, not merely a technical expense. The protection gained through proper security implementation typically delivers substantial returns by preventing the devastating costs of breaches and downtime.

Written By Jason Boyd

An experienced WordPress specialist with 20+ years of experience transforming problematic websites into high-performing business assets through technical excellence in performance, security, SEO and sustainable development.

>Read More About Jason

Further Reading

Voice Search Optimisation for WordPress

Jason Boyd

/

WordPress SEO

The Hidden Costs of DIY WordPress Development

Jason Boyd

/

WordPress Development

Is Your WordPress Site Costing You Customers?

Jason Boyd

/

WordPress Performance

Let's talk WordPress!


    Partners

    I've worked with

     
    NHS Scotland
    GE Capital
    Fujitsu
    Openreach
    Nalanda
    Vitality-Pro